Considering that asphalt and concrete are the two primarily made use of materials, right here are a few of the substantial differences between them: Asphalt fracture repairs are check not as unpleasant as concrete. DIY fixings to concrete entail sealing splits with caulk and also loading openings with patching product, and also those fixings are rather visible. Although concrete often tends to be more resilient, it is a lot more conscious cold climate and also cracks simpler than asphalt.


It can improve the curb allure of your residence and also enhance its style. Asphalt color options are paving layout planner restricted to black or grey. If you want a details style or color that can be engraved, stamped, tinted, or discolored, choose concrete. Concrete reflects light and also soaks up less warmth than asphalt, and also you can walk barefoot on it in the summer.

It's vulnerable to splitting from freezing as well as thawing. Concrete can't manage snowplows and road salt well, so concrete is far better suited for warm environments, while asphalt is much better for winter season climate regions. If budget plan is your most substantial consideration, after that asphalt is your ideal alternative. You can anticipate that it will be half the price of a concrete driveway, although you will certainly be limited by one color, and also expect that you will likely need to resurface or replace it in 20 years.
